X Chat: Full Guide to Features, Encryption, Privacy & Grok AI Integration

Image credits to Rootnation
X (formerly Twitter) has launched X Chat, the platform’s most advanced messaging system to date. This major rollout replaces the older DM architecture with a fully redesigned communication suite offering end to end encrypted chats, voice and video calling, disappearing messages, file sharing, and advanced privacy controls.
This is a major step toward Elon Musk’s vision of turning X into an “everything app” similar to China’s WeChat combining social media, messaging, payments, and AI into one ecosystem. With over 600 million monthly users already on X, X Chat has the potential to quickly become one of the world’s largest encrypted messaging platforms.

What Is X Chat? Key Features Explained
X Chat is a complete rebuild of X’s messaging system. It merges legacy DMs and encrypted conversations into a single, unified inbox, offering a modern messaging experience with stronger security, better performance, and more flexible communication tools.
Core Features
End to End Encrypted Messaging
All chats, media, and files are encrypted before they leave your device and can only be decrypted by the recipient.
Voice and Video Calling
Native high quality calling without needing a phone number.
File Sharing
Supports all file types with encrypted transmission.
Disappearing Messages
Automatically delete messages after a custom timer.
Screenshot Protection
You can block screenshots entirely or receive alerts if someone attempts to capture your messages.
Message Editing & Deletion
Full edit and delete options with no “message deleted” placeholder.
Ad Free Messaging
No ads or tracking inside X Chat.
Unified Inbox
Legacy DMs and new encrypted chats appear together in a single interface.
X Chat’s End to End Encryption: Strong but Not Perfect
X Chat uses a public private key cryptography system to encrypt all content. A private key is protected by a user created PIN and stored in encrypted form on X’s infrastructure. Every conversation has a unique encryption key shared between participants.
While encryption exists, several limitations affect overall security:
Major Security Concerns
- No protection against man in the middle attacks X itself could theoretically intercept or modify keys because users cannot verify each other’s keys.
- Metadata remains unencrypted Sender/receiver info, timestamps, and conversation participants are visible to X.
- No forward secrecy A static conversation key is used for all messages. If compromised, the entire chat history is exposed.
- Private keys stored on X servers Unlike Signal, which stores keys locally, X stores them remotely.
- No identity verification Users cannot verify device safety numbers or fingerprints.
These limitations mean X Chat is suitable for day to day conversations but not recommended for extremely sensitive information.
Grok AI on X — How It Relates to X Chat
Grok, X’s AI assistant built by xAI, is integrated across the X platform. It provides real time answers, pulls data directly from X posts, and can generate content, images, and summaries.
However:
- Grok is not currently integrated inside X Chat conversations.
- AI assisted messaging features may arrive in the future.
Potential integrations might include real time translation, automated replies, summarizing long chats, and intelligent search.
X Chat Groups and Communication Options
X Chat supports encrypted one on one and group messaging.
Group Chat Features
- Encrypted group chats
- Admin tools: add/remove participants, manage permissions
- Encrypted file and media sharing
X Chat groups should not be confused with:
- X Spaces — live audio rooms for public conversations
- X Communities — topic based discussion spaces
- X Chat Groups — private encrypted message threads
All X Chat groups remain private and secure between selected participants.
Cross Platform Availability
iOS
Fully supported with all features available.
Web
All X Chat tools are accessible through desktop browsers.
Android
Coming soon after the full app redesign.
Cross Device Sync
- Conversations sync across devices
- Private keys recoverable using your PIN
- Draft syncing works between mobile and web (text only)

X Money Integration (Coming Soon)
X Money, X’s upcoming payments feature, will integrate into X Chat. This will enable:
- In chat money transfers
- Tipping creators
- Payments for services
- Digital wallet functionality with Visa support
This is central to X’s “everything app” strategy.
How X Chat Compares with WhatsApp, Telegram & Instagram DM
| Comparison | X Chat | Competitor |
|---|---|---|
| X Chat vs WhatsApp | ||
| Encryption Strength | Weaker encryption, lacks forward secrecy | Stronger encryption with forward secrecy |
| Screenshot Blocking | Yes, supports screenshot blocking and true deletion | No screenshot blocking |
| Metadata Protection | Weaker metadata protection | Better metadata protection |
| X Chat vs Telegram | ||
| Default Encryption | End to end encryption enabled by default | E2EE only in Secret Chats, not default |
| Group Features | Smaller groups, no bot ecosystem | Massive groups, extensive bot support |
| Privacy Approach | More privacy focused | More feature rich but less private by default |
| X Chat vs Signal | ||
| Privacy Level | Less secure, lacks key verification & forward secrecy | Gold standard privacy, open source, strong cryptography |
| Cryptographic Strength | Falls short of Signal’s protections | Industry leading encryption |
| Platform Integration | Integrated with social feed | Standalone messaging only |
| X Chat vs Instagram DM | ||
| Encryption | Default end to end encryption | Optional E2EE, not default |
| Commerce Features | Limited, commerce coming via X Money | Strong shopping and business tools |
| Privacy Focus | Stronger privacy emphasis | More commerce and business oriented |

Final Verdict
X Chat introduces a powerful, feature rich messaging system within the X platform. For everyday conversations, social interactions, and general private chats, it provides strong convenience and better privacy than legacy DMs. Screenshot blocking, encrypted file sharing, and true message deletion make it appealing, especially for active X users.
However, X Chat’s encryption system still lacks key protections found in mature secure messaging apps. Until features like forward secrecy and key verification arrive, X Chat should not be used for high risk or highly confidential communications.
Rating: 7/10
Great potential, impressive features, but still evolving on the security side.
